I finished up the install this morning. When I first started it, it ticked very loud for a couple of minutes then the tick went away and stayed away. I cleaned the front of the motor along with the ace and PS pump and lines.
Here's what I used/replaced:
Rocker arms
Rocker arm shafts
Oil filler o-ring
Coolant hose (intake to throttle body)
70mm idler puller
80mm idler pulley bearing
Valley gasket and end seals
Intake Plenum gasket
Throttle body gasket
Coolant pipe o-rings
Valve cover gaskets
Injector o-rings
